Fun was had by all yesterday at Liepold Farms in Boring, Oregon, for our annual Fall Party. We couldn’t have asked for better weather and nicer people working at the farm. There was a large corn maze, dark hay maze (bring your flashlights for that!), Kid Pavilion, a country store, cute cutouts for picture ops, plenty of large and small pumpkins to choose from, a hay ride with a quick educational chat on how a pumpkin grows, and lastly, but probably the most popular event, the Pumpkin-pult. Hoffman Family Farms in Canby officially opens on October 7th, but hosts parties like ours before then. Although a few of the usual attractions were not yet open (hay maze, reptile haunted house, and rides), we were still able to experience quite a bit: The inflatable bouncy house, slide, and obstacle course; carefully feeding the goats, alpacas, and sheep; a very bumpy tractor ride around the property; having professional pictures taken; viewing wild animals, including a lion and a tiger!; chowing down on a variety of delicious homemade chili; admiring cute little ones dressed up in costumes; eating Good Old Larry’s Kettle Corn; and last, but certainly not least, choosing a small pumpkin to take home.
